Oracle SQL Developer

Skill in demand · Lightcast

Oracle SQL Developer is a specialized skill in the Lightcast Open Skills taxonomy — the vocabulary employers use to describe what work requires. It maps to 2 occupations that together employ about 672,820 workers, with a median wage of $110,780. Its reach across the occupation map is low.

This page is built from a crosswalk that maps each occupation's O*NET knowledge, skill, and ability requirements to the named Lightcast skill — it reflects which jobs require the skill, not a direct count of job postings. Employment and pay are BLS OEWS national figures for the occupations, not for the skill itself.

Occupations that need this skill

Occupations whose O*NET requirements map to Oracle SQL Developer, ranked by employment. Wage and employment are BLS OEWS (national, cross-industry, May 2024).

Occupation Workers Median pay
Document Management Specialists 439,380 $108,970
Business Intelligence Analysts 233,440 $112,590
